drm/amdgpu:don't change ctx->reset_couner upon query

reset_counter marks the reset counter number once the context
is created, shouldn't be changed due to query.

To keep U/K interface on the ctx_query and keep ctx's reset_counter
logic compatible with GPU RESET feature, now use another var named
"reset_counter_query" to replace the original checked & updated in
amdgpu_ctx_query.
